You do realize that having a series widely available (as much as HBO can be counted "widely available") in a different medium is actually very likely to attract people back to the original medium, yes? I know a good amount of show fans who turned around and gave the books a try because they liked what they saw and they talked with book fans who encouraged them instead of referring to them as "illiterate fucks."
Second! Have you taken a look at how stupidly frigging huge these books are? The entire Harry Potter series is about as long as the first three put together, and there are five and counting. Each ASoIaF novel still requires a map and an index of houses and who's in what to even keep track of what's going on, and even then it's tough to remember everything that's happening. These are long, complicated books, and not everyone is up for reading them. Some people read slowly and would rather pick books that won't take them over a year to complete. Some people don't want something that complicated. Some people can follow things better if they see the action onscreen. Someone enjoying a different interpretation of the same story does not make them a lesser fan than you, especially since GRRM works on the show himself and approves the changes.
Third! Sounds like most of your anger is at your coworkers. Maybe you can explain to them that HBO is expensive/you don't want it/whatever. Sounds like they might not understand that fact.
Overall: "READ SOMETHING YOU GODDAMN ILLITERATE FUCKS" is a terrible way to get someone to read. Take a step back, try to understand the situation, and try a different approach.
